瀏覽代碼

feat: default timezone to user's local timezone in activate form (#5374)

Charles Zhou 10 月之前
父節點
當前提交
2b0c779173
共有 1 個文件被更改,包括 1 次插入2 次删除
  1. 1 2
      web/app/activate/activateForm.tsx

+ 1 - 2
web/app/activate/activateForm.tsx

@@ -41,10 +41,9 @@ const ActivateForm = () => {
 
   const [name, setName] = useState('')
   const [password, setPassword] = useState('')
-  const [timezone, setTimezone] = useState('Asia/Shanghai')
+  const [timezone, setTimezone] = useState(Intl.DateTimeFormat().resolvedOptions().timeZone)
   const [language, setLanguage] = useState(locale)
   const [showSuccess, setShowSuccess] = useState(false)
-  const defaultLanguage = useCallback(() => (window.navigator.language.startsWith('zh') ? LanguagesSupported[1] : LanguagesSupported[0]) || LanguagesSupported[0], [])
 
   const showErrorMessage = useCallback((message: string) => {
     Toast.notify({